少儿 Python 和成人 Python 的区别是什么?
在当今数字化时代,编程语言已经成为一种重要的工具。Python 作为一种广泛使用的编程语言,不仅在学术界和工业界受到青睐,也逐渐在少儿编程教育中崭露头角。少儿 Python 和成人 Python 之间存在一些明显的区别。这些区别,并分析它们对学习和应用的影响。
学习目标
少儿 Python 的主要目标是培养孩子的编程兴趣和思维能力,通过有趣的项目和游戏激发他们对计算机科学的热爱。而成人 Python 则更注重于提升工作效率、解决实际问题和开发复杂的应用程序。
学习内容
少儿 Python 通常涵盖基础的编程概念,如变量、数据类型、控制结构和函数。教材和课程可能会使用图形化编程工具,以帮助孩子更容易理解编程逻辑。相比之下,成人 Python 学习会深入探讨更高级的主题,如面向对象编程、数据结构、算法、数据库操作和网络编程等。
学习方式
少儿编程教育通常采用互动式的学习方式,结合游戏、故事和动画,使学习过程更具趣味性和吸引力。教师或家长可能会在旁边引导和帮助孩子,鼓励他们积极探索和实践。而成人学习 Python 可能更倾向于通过阅读书籍、观看视频教程和参加线下培训来自主学习。
应用场景
少儿 Python 主要应用于教育和娱乐领域,如制作动画、小游戏和教育工具。它可以帮助孩子提高创造力和解决问题。成人 Python 则广泛应用于各个行业,如科学研究、数据分析、人工智能、Web 开发和自动化等。掌握 Python 可以为成人在工作中提供更多的职业发展机会。
学习资源
针对少儿的 Python 学习资源丰富多样,包括在线教育平台、儿童编程书籍、教育游戏和线下编程活动等。这些资源通常设计得适合孩子的年龄和学习水平。而成人学习 Python 的资源也很丰富,但可能更侧重于专业书籍、在线课程和编程社区。
社区和支持
少儿编程社区通常更加活跃和多样化,有许多针对孩子的编程比赛、活动和分享会。家长和孩子可以通过参与社区活动,结交志同道合的朋友,提高学习动力。成人 Python 社区也非常活跃,但更多地关注技术交流和项目合作。
少儿 Python 和成人 Python 在学习目标、内容、方式、应用场景、学习资源和社区支持等方面存在明显的区别。这些区别反映了不同年龄段和学习需求的特点。对于少儿来说,Python 可以作为一种启蒙工具,培养他们的兴趣和创造力;而成人则可以通过深入学习 Python 提升自己的职业竞争力和解决实际问题。
在实际应用中,我们可以根据个人的需求和目标选择适合的 Python 学习路径。无论是少儿还是成人,持续学习和实践是提高编程技能的关键。通过不断探索和应用 Python,我们可以在各个领域中发挥其强大的功能,创造出更多有意义的成果。
希望能够帮助读者更好地理解少儿 Python 和成人 Python 的区别,并为他们选择合适的学习方式提供一些参考。让我们一起在 Python 的世界中不断成长和进步!